Need a Safe Place to Hide Small Valuables? Watch This Cool Video.

Using few tools that you can easily find at home, you can also create your own awesome secret safe in just 10 minutes! It’s a cool way to hide your valuables. You can safely hide it away in plain sight. By simply twisting the top of the can, it will reveal the secret compartment.

Here’s what you need:

  • a can of soup
  • a mason jar that fits in your soup can
  • a hot glue gun
  • a can opener
  • some expanding foam

What’s awesome about this is that, these cans are very difficult to tell apart from the genuine product. It even weighed like an ordinary unopened can. You can store it in your pantry with all the other soup cans and anyone won’t even tell the difference. It’s an awesome way to stash some extra cash and small valuables such as jewelry and important memory cards that contains “confidential” data.
